Shabebe Deep Pour Epoxy Resin is a premium 3-gallon industrial-grade kit designed for thick pours between 2 to 4 inches. Featuring a crystal-clear, UV-resistant finish and a user-friendly 2:1 mixing ratio, it offers a generous 60-80 minute working time and fast curing within 24-48 hours. Perfect for professional and DIY projects like river tables, bar tops, and wood crafts, this food-safe, non-toxic resin ensures durable, bubble-free results that resist yellowing and cracking.

DOSE NOT DRY IN 24 hours this product is a mixture of 2 to 1
This product dries in 72 hours and I gave it three stars because of limited bubbles and when it dries, it looks nice. You will read in other reviews that people mixed it 1 to 1 ratio, but it clearly states on the bottle 2 to 1 ratio. If you were to mix it one to one, you would have a half a bottle of resin left after all said and done.
